Does My Personal Auto Insurance Cover Business Use?

What Is Business Auto Insurance?



Business auto insurance is an insurance policy specifically for vehicles used for business purposes. It is a type of commercial auto insurance that covers you and your employees if your business owns vehicles, or if you or your employees use your own vehicles for business purposes. This type of insurance covers you for liability and physical damage to your vehicle, as well as other expenses such as medical payments and uninsured motorist coverage. Business auto insurance is important for businesses that use vehicles for business purposes, as it can provide protection from costly lawsuits and other financial losses.

Do I Need Business Auto Insurance?



The answer to this question depends on how your vehicles are used. If your business owns vehicles, you will need to purchase business auto insurance. Even if you don’t own vehicles, but you or your employees use personal vehicles for business purposes, you may need to purchase business auto insurance. Personal auto insurance usually does not cover business use, so it is important to check with your insurance company to determine what type of coverage is right for you.

What Does Business Auto Insurance Cover?



Business auto insurance covers a variety of expenses. It covers liability, physical damage to your vehicle, medical payments, uninsured motorist coverage, and other expenses. It also can cover rental vehicles and any vehicles used for business purposes. Depending on the type of policy you purchase, it may also cover towing and labor costs. It is important to understand the types of coverage available so that you can purchase the coverage that is right for your business.

Does My Personal Auto Insurance Cover Business Use?



In most cases, personal auto insurance does not cover business use. Personal auto insurance is designed to cover personal use, such as commuting to and from work, running errands, and other recreational activities. It does not cover business use, such as transporting goods or passengers, or delivering products and services. If you or your employees use personal vehicles for business purposes, you will need to purchase business auto insurance in order to be protected.
